An electric dipole is placed along the x axis at the origin O.a point P is at distance of 20 cm from this origin such that OP makes π/3 with the x-axis .if the electric field at P makes an angle theta with the x acis the value of theta would be

The value of theta would be 101°

Explanation:

=> According to the figure,

θ = α + 60

=> If we resolve E into its component, then we get

Ecosα = 2pcos60/4πε₀r³   ...(1)

Esinα = psin60/4πε₀r³        ...(2)

=> If divide eq(2) by eq(1), we get

tanα = 1/2 * tan60

tanα = √3/2

α = tan⁻¹ √3/2

α = 41⁰

=> If we place value of α in above eq of θ, we get

θ = 60 + α

θ = 60 + 41

θ = 101°

Thus, the value of theta would be 101°
